What Is a Mobile Operator Round App?

Operator rounds, the routine walk through a site to check equipment and record readings, have traditionally been done with a clipboard and a paper form. A mobile operator round app moves that whole activity onto a phone or tablet: it guides the technician along the route, prompts for each reading, captures the values and photos on the spot, and syncs it all back to the central system. Mobile operator round app in one line: A mobile operator round app is a phone or tablet application that guides a technician through a predefined route of equipment checks, prompting for and capturing manual readings, observations, and photos at each stop, then syncing the collected data back to SCADA or a central system. It digitizes the operator round, replacing the paper clipboard with a guided, validated, timestamped capture that feeds directly into the operation's data.

Walking a Guided Route on a Device

The core of a round app is that it turns the route into a guided sequence rather than a blank form. The technician's round is defined as an ordered set of stops, each with the specific checks and readings expected there, and the app leads them through it stop by stop. At each point it presents exactly what to record, a gauge reading, a level, a temperature, a visual condition, so nothing is left to memory and the round is walked the same way every time regardless of who is doing it.

As the technician works, the app captures the data directly at the source. A numeric reading is typed or, on equipment that supports it, scanned or read from a connected instrument; an observation is chosen from defined options; a photo of a leak or a nameplate is attached to the relevant step. Every entry is stamped with the time and the person who made it, and the app can validate as it goes, flagging a value that falls outside a plausible range so an obvious mis-key or a genuinely abnormal reading is caught while the technician is still standing in front of the equipment.

Because field sites often have poor or no connectivity, a round app is built to work offline. It holds the route and captures all the data locally on the device as the technician walks, with no assumption of a live connection at the equipment. When the device regains signal, back at a truck, an office, or a cellular pocket, it syncs the completed round up to the central system. This offline-first design is what makes the app usable in exactly the remote, signal-poor places where rounds most often happen.

Why an App Replaces the Clipboard

The paper clipboard has quiet but serious weaknesses that a round app directly addresses. Handwritten readings must be transcribed into a computer later, a step that is slow and introduces errors, and until that transcription happens the data does not exist anywhere useful. Paper forms also do not enforce anything: a step can be skipped, a reading left blank, or a form filled in from the truck rather than at the equipment, and no one can tell after the fact. The record is only as reliable as the discipline of the person holding the pen.

A round app closes these gaps by capturing structured, validated data once, at the source. There is no transcription step because the reading is already digital the moment it is entered, so it flows into the system without a second pass and without the errors that pass introduces. The app can require that steps be completed before a round is marked done, so blanks and skipped checks are caught, and timestamps on each entry make it far harder to fabricate a round done from the parking lot. The result is data that is both more complete and more trustworthy than a paper form.

Beyond data quality, the app makes the round itself better executed. The guided route means a new or relieving technician does not need to have memorized what to check where; the app tells them. Consistency improves because everyone follows the same defined sequence and records the same fields. And immediate validation turns each round into a chance to catch a problem on the spot, an out-of-range reading flagged in the field prompts a closer look while the technician is right there, rather than being noticed days later when someone finally reviews the paper. Replacing the clipboard is not just digitizing paperwork; it is making the round more reliable and more useful.

Round Apps and Cloud SCADA

A mobile operator round app is the natural manual complement to a cloud SCADA platform such as Merobix. SCADA continuously captures what the instruments measure, but plenty of the things a technician checks on a round are not instrumented, a visual inspection, a reading off a local gauge, the sound or vibration of a machine, a lubricant level. The round app captures exactly that manual, human-observed data and syncs it into the same platform, so the automated telemetry and the field observations sit together in one record instead of the manual half living on paper in a filing cabinet.

This integration lets the two kinds of data reinforce each other. A local gauge reading captured on a round can be compared against the transmitter's value for the same point, revealing instrument drift; a technician's note that a pump sounded rough can be read alongside its trended current; a manual tank gauge can back up a level sensor. Because the round data lands in the platform tied to the same sites and equipment, it enriches the operational picture rather than existing as a separate, disconnected paperwork trail.

For an operation running rounds across many sites, the round app also gives the central team visibility into field work that paper never could. Managers can see that rounds were completed, when, and by whom, review the captured readings and photos as they sync in, and spot flagged abnormalities across sites, all without waiting for forms to be collected and transcribed. Frequently Asked Questions

How is a round app different from operator rounds in general?

Operator rounds are the routine activity itself, walking a site to check equipment and record readings, regardless of the tools used. A mobile operator round app is the modern way of executing that activity: it delivers the route on a phone or tablet, prompts for each reading, validates and timestamps the capture, and syncs it to the central system. The rounds are the work; the app is how the work is now done and recorded.

Does a round app need a network connection at each site?

No, a good round app is offline-first. It holds the route and captures all readings, observations, and photos locally on the device, with no assumption of connectivity at the equipment, which is essential because field sites are often in poor-signal areas. The completed round syncs up to the central system whenever the device regains a connection, so the technician is never blocked by a lack of signal while walking the route.

Why replace paper rounds forms with an app?

A paper form must be transcribed later, which is slow and error-prone, and it enforces nothing, so steps can be skipped or a reading filled in away from the equipment with no way to tell. An app captures structured, validated data once at the source, requires steps be completed, timestamps each entry, and can flag out-of-range readings on the spot. The result is more complete, more trustworthy data and a more consistently executed round.
